Output 66ca2489de60435188e61170d870bdb4a43cb83a75dac7bdda4caffe1781c671:1

value
2077808
script pubkey
OP_0 OP_PUSHBYTES_20 23e1ad0690c7bd599d92e8290845aeac0779a953
address
ltc1qy0s66p5sc774n8vjaq5ss3dw4srhn22nnvh67t
transaction
66ca2489de60435188e61170d870bdb4a43cb83a75dac7bdda4caffe1781c671
spent
true